Двигается игрок двигается машина | Unity, что я сделал не так?

Если игрок движется, но машина нет, то, скорее всего, проблема может быть в коде или настройках движения машины в Unity. Ниже предложены несколько возможных причин и рекомендации по их исправлению: 1. Неправильно настроены компоненты движения машины: Убедитесь, что на машине установлены необходимые компоненты, такие как Rigidbody (позволяет объекту реагировать на физическое взаимодействие), Collider (обеспечивает столкновение ... Читать далее

Не отображается нормально(естественно) текстура в UI элементе Image, что я сделал не так?

Если текстура не отображается правильно в элементе Image в Unity, есть несколько возможных причин и решений: 1. Проверьте настройки текстуры: Убедитесь, что ваши текстуры имеют правильные настройки. В Unity вы можете изменить настройки текстуры, включая тип сжатия и формат файла. Убедитесь, что ваша текстура имеет правильный формат и настройки. 2. Загрузка текстуры: Проверьте, что текстура ... Читать далее

Как лучше всего воспроизводить разовый звук (клик например)?

В Unity есть несколько способов воспроизвести разовый звук, такой как клик. Вот несколько способов, которые вы можете использовать: 1. Audio Source: Создайте пустой игровой объект в сцене и добавьте к нему компонент Audio Source. Загрузите звуковой файл в свойство Audio Clip этого компонента. Вы можете воспроизвести этот звук при помощи кода, вызвав метод Play у ... Читать далее

Как правильно двигать объекты по нарисованным линиям?

В Unity есть несколько способов двигать объекты по нарисованным линиям, и выбор зависит от конкретных требований и возможностей проекта. Вот несколько способов, которые можно использовать: 1. Использование компонента LineRenderer: - Создайте объект с компонентом LineRenderer, добавьте точки в массив positions этого компонента для отображения линии. - Создайте пустой GameObject и закрепите его за точкой начала ... Читать далее

Пуля при попадании передает много энергии объекту?

Вопрос о передаче энергии пулей при попадании в объект в Unity может быть рассмотрен с точки зрения физики и взаимодействия объектов в движке. Во-первых, стоит отметить, что в Unity можно создать различные сценарии поведения пули и объекта при попадании. Реалистичность передачи энергии зависит от выбранной модели физики и настроек в Unity. В Unity для моделирования ... Читать далее

Как подключить клиентов через сервер (NetCode, Entities)?

Для подключения клиентов через сервер в Unity с использованием NetCode и Entities, вам необходимо выполнить следующие шаги: 1. Установите пакеты NetCode и Entities: Откройте окно Package Manager в Unity, включите поддержку этого движка и установите последние версии пакетов NetCode и Entities. 2. Создайте счетчик клиентов: В вашем серверном проекте создайте счетчик, который будет отслеживать количество ... Читать далее

Как в юнити оптимально отображать часто меняющийся текст?

В Unity есть несколько способов оптимально отображать часто меняющийся текст. Один из самых распространенных способов - использование компонента TextMeshPro. TextMeshPro - это расширенная версия стандартного компонента Text в Unity, которая имеет множество возможностей для настройки текста. Она предоставляет более качественный шрифт, лучшую производительность и больше возможностей форматирования. Для использования TextMeshPro вам необходимо сначала импортировать его ... Читать далее

Перемещение камеры при входе в комнату коллайдер на всю комнату или на дверь?

При разработке игры в Unity, выбор стиля перемещения камеры при входе в комнату может сильно варьироваться в зависимости от желаемого эффекта и требований вашей игры. Одним из распространенных подходов является размещение коллайдера на всю комнату. Это означает, что при попадании игрока в коллайдер, камера может автоматически переместиться в новое положение. Это позволяет достичь плавных переходов ... Читать далее

Как в Unity сделать анимацию длиннее секунды?

В Unity, анимации обычно создаются на основе временных кадров (keyframes), где каждый кадр представляет определенное состояние объекта или параметра в заданный момент времени. По умолчанию, Unity использует систему времени, измеряемую в секундах, для определения продолжительности анимации. Однако, для создания анимаций, длительность которых превышает секунду, можно использовать несколько методов. 1. Создание анимаций с использованием clip-ов: - ... Читать далее

Как сделать вложенные объекты в массив в WWWForm?

Для создания вложенных объектов в массиве в экземпляре класса WWWForm в Unity, вы можете использовать методы форматирования запроса, такие как AddField и AddBinaryData. Для начала, создайте экземпляр класса WWWForm: WWWForm form = new WWWForm(); Затем, используйте метод AddField для добавления элементов простых типов в форму: form.AddField("fieldName", value); Для добавления вложенных объектов в массив воспользуйтесь методом ... Читать далее